WebNov 10, 2013 · One of the most common signs of emotional crisis is a clear and abrupt change in behavior. Some examples include: Neglect of personal hygiene. Dramatic change in sleep habits, such a sleeping more often or not sleeping well. Weight gain or loss. Decline in performance at work or school. WebEach crisis consists of a dilemma or choice that carries both advantages and risks, but in which one choice or alternative is normally considered more desirable or “healthy.” How one crisis is resolved affects how later crises are resolved. The resolution to each crisis also helps to create an individual’s developing personality. WebA humanitarian crisis is defined as a singular event or a series of events that are threatening in terms of health, safety or well-being of a community or large group of people. It may be an internal or external conflict and usually occurs throughout a large land area.
